The Down’s Syndrome Association seeks a Partnerships Officer to grow its Work Fit employment initiative and to build meaningful partnerships with businesses and community fundraisers across the UK.
The role focuses on generating income, raising awareness and supporting people with Down’s syndrome to access purposeful work.
The successful candidate will work 35 hours per week, with three days in the Teddington office and two days working from home.
